Overall Educational Objective To enable students to develop their professional skills by combining academic knowledge and theoretical foundations with practical experiences. This course provides students with real-world experience in the business world, helping them acquire the competencies necessary for their careers.
Course Description Internship offers students an opportunity to combine their theoretical knowledge with practical experiences during their academic education. In this context, students gain real work experience in a specific business or organization. During the internship period, students get to know the business environment, improve their professional skills and prepare for business life by working in a specific department or project within the company. Internships help students explore their professional interests, understand expectations in the business world, and achieve their career goals.
